Deprecation framework for Twisted.
To mark a method, function, or class as being deprecated do this::
from incremental import Version
from twisted.python.deprecate import deprecated
@deprecated(Version("Twisted", 8, 0, 0))
def badAPI(self, first, second):
'''
Docstring for badAPI.
'''
...
@deprecated(Version("Twisted", 16, 0, 0))
class BadClass:
'''
Docstring for BadClass.
'''
The newly-decorated badAPI will issue a warning when called, and BadClass will
issue a warning when instantiated. Both will also have a deprecation notice
appended to their docstring.
To deprecate properties you can use::
from incremental import Version
from twisted.python.deprecate import deprecatedProperty
class OtherwiseUndeprecatedClass:
@deprecatedProperty(Version('Twisted', 16, 0, 0))
def badProperty(self):
'''
Docstring for badProperty.
'''
@badProperty.setter
def badProperty(self, value):
'''
Setter sill also raise the deprecation warning.
'''
To mark module-level attributes as being deprecated you can use::
badAttribute = "someValue"
...
deprecatedModuleAttribute(
Version("Twisted", 8, 0, 0),
"Use goodAttribute instead.",
"your.full.module.name",
"badAttribute")
The deprecated attributes will issue a warning whenever they are accessed. If
the attributes being deprecated are in the same module as the
L{deprecatedModuleAttribute} call is being made from, the C{__name__} global
can be used as the C{moduleName} parameter.
To mark an optional, keyword parameter of a function or method as deprecated
without deprecating the function itself, you can use::
@deprecatedKeywordParameter(Version("Twisted", 19, 2, 0), 'baz')
def someFunction(foo, bar=0, baz=None):
...
See also L{incremental.Version}.
